Webb25 apr. 2024 · Most of these rules of thumb are based on some multiple of revenue, sales, or earnings. Some are as simple as taking your small business' yearly cash flow and multiplying it by four. For example, if your business generates cash flow of $60,000 per year, it would have a value of $240,000. However, these rules of thumb can vary … WebbBusiness Valuation. Calculator. WebbThis tool calculates two ‘valuations’ based upon your sales, cost of sales and other factors: A simplified Seller’s Discretionary Earnings (SDE) valuation. This valuation is best suited to businesses valued at below $5,000,000. A simplified Earnings Before Interest, Taxes, Depreciation and Amortization (EBITDA) valuation.
